On Monday, August 15, 2011 05:09:42 Valentin Longchamp wrote:
> On 08/14/2011 09:07 PM, Mike Frysinger wrote:
> > On Wednesday, August 03, 2011 08:37:00 Valentin Longchamp wrote:
> >> --- a/include/post.h
> >> +++ b/include/post.h
> >>
> >> +/*
> >> + * some ARM implementations have to use gd->ram_size, since POST_WORD
> >> is + * defined in RAM
> >> + */
> >> +DECLARE_GLOBAL_DATA_PTR;
> >
> > i'm not sure about this. no other header has been allowed to do this in
> > the past, and i dont think we should start now.
>
> OK. Then we should move the post_word_load and post_word_store function to
> post/post.c. Would this be accepted ?
that would add overhead that most people dont need. i guess the only other
option would be to add a CONFIG_POST_EXTERNAL_WORD_FUNCS and then post.h would
just define the two funcs as externs. it'd be up to the board porters to
define them however they want.
-mike
